The spoiler on a WRX RA 1997 model would be a lower level spoiler same as the 1997 UK spoiler IIRC. the bigger spolier came in on the STI4 and progressed to the WRX and UKs in later MYs. Only the STI had strut braces IIRC and all had a standrad filter ie. no induction kits so yes sounds modded to me.
